Mechanically, Parallax Nexus offers a complex interplay of risk and reward that has captivated players for decades. The card enters the battlefield with five fade counters, meaning it will eventually be sacrificed unless its owner actively maintains it. By removing a counter during their upkeep, the controller can force an opponent to exile a card from their hand, effectively removing a key resource from the game. This interaction creates a tense dynamic, as the user must balance the card's temporary presence against the strategic advantage of disrupting their opponent's hand. The card's final ability ensures that the game state resets when the Nexus leaves play, returning all exiled cards to their owners' hands. Abilities, attacks, oracle text, and flavor text printed on the card.
Fading 5 (This enchantment enters with five fade counters on it. At the beginning of your upkeep, remove a fade counter from it. If you can't, sacrifice it.) Remove a fade counter from this enchantment: Target opponent exiles a card from their hand. Activate only as a sorcery. When this enchantment leaves the battlefield, each player returns to their hand all cards they own exiled with it.
